Job Summary
Based in the Bedford office, the Talent Acquisition Coordinator plays a critical role in delivering an exceptional candidate and hiring manager experience by engaging stakeholders across all stages of the hiring process and supporting interview scheduling, offers, and onboarding. This position requires the execution of both routine and non-routine administrative tasks and other assignments/projects which support the talent acquisition team.
Job Responsibilities:
Supports Recruiters in various steps of the recruitment processes, schedules orientations, and utilises necessary resources to assess and complete tasks related to work authorisation, reference and background checks, and new hire onboarding. Maintains confidentiality and documentation in accordance with retention policies. Ensures data has been entered correctly and makes corrections as applicable. Processing candidate expenses as required. (30%)
Delivers an excellent candidate experience by coordinating interview schedules and ensuring a seamless on-site interview arrival process through timely stakeholder notification. Updates Applicant Tracking System (ATS) as required. Provides support with posting advertisements and updating roles on job boards. (30%)
Engages and builds strong relationships with Hiring Managers, Candidates, HR, and other business stakeholders. Manages general incoming communications to Talent Acquisition team. Determines appropriate routing and/or escalation as needed, delivering timely and accurate (20%)
Prepares and distributes daily, weekly and monthly Talent Acquisition-related reports. Updates data and compiles departmental metrics as directed. (10%)
Represents Universal United Kingdom Resort at on‑site and external job fairs, careers events and community activities. Prepares for and follows up on events and actively engages with attendees by promoting current vacancies and providing information about the organisation. (10%)
